httpd not running after reboot

I have an old AS/200 running RedHat 7.1 as an apache, MySQL, and PHP server.  
After reboot I can't get apache to start.  I keep getting errors like . . .

alpha_fp_emul: Invalid FP insn 0x4f938 at 0x2000110dc78

in messages.  But, if I start up XFree, apache will then start running.  
Though it does have lots of . . . 

httpd: unaligned trap at 000002000003a468: 47e0041847eb0c42 28 2

errors in the messages log.  Any ideas?  I seem to remember someone talking 
about seeding the random number generator and getting XFree to load quickly, 
which might have something to do with this.  I couldn't find it in the 
archives, and I might just be on crack.
